BD Barricor™ Tube provides value for plasma and serum users
Benefits vs plasma and serum tubes
- Reduces turn-around time:
- By up to 7 minutes for plasma and serum users (faster centrifugation)
- By up to 30 minutes for serum users (eliminates clotting time)
- Reduces time-to-result by up to 37 minutes
- Potential to reduce sample inspection and remediation
- Potential to reduce instrument maintenance
- Eliminates need to draw a second tube for hydrophobic TDMs
Specific benefits vs plasma tubes
- May reduce false positives (and retesting) with plasma on high-sensitivity immunoassays
- Extends analyte stability for plasma from 24 hours to 7 days (AST, potassium, phosphate)

BD Barricor™ Performance vs. BD PST™
| Blood collection tube (g-force/time) | ||
| Attribute | BD PST™ (1300G/10 mins, 4.5 mL) |
BD Barricor™ (4000G/3 mins, 4.5 mL) |
| Centrifugation time | 10 min | 3 min |
| Gel globules | Episodic | None |
| Red cell adhesion occurence rate (RBC Hangup) | 69% | 3% |
| Diagnostic accuracy (average cell counts for mixed samples) | ||
| Residual White Cells1 | 0.768 x 103 cells/μL | 0.202 x 103 cells/μL - On average 74% fewer |
| Residual Red Cells1 | 0.0090 x 106 cells/μL | 0.0040 x 106 cells/μL - On average 56% fewer |
| Residual Platelets1 |
78.09 x 103 cells/μL | 36.62 x 103 cells/μL - On average 55% fewer |
| Chemistry stability2 |
Less than 7 days stability for: AST, K, Phosphate | 7 day stability for : AST, K, Phosphate |
| TDM stability3 |
No Claim | 7 day stability for representative TDMs including hydrophobic drugs |
| Infectious diseases | No | Yes (CE marked product only) |
| Plasma yield | 52% | 43% (0.4 mL less sample) |
AST: aspartate aminotransferase, K: potassium, TDM: therapeutic drug monitoring
14.5 mL BD PSTTM and BD BarriorTM Tubes
2Analyte stability tested at 24 hours room temperature and additional 6 days refrigerated (2-8°C)
3Analyte stability tested at 48 hours room temperature and additional 5 days refrigerated (2-8°C)
BD Barricor™ Performance vs. BD SST™
| Blood collection tube (g-force/time) | ||
| Attribute | BD SST™ (1300G/10 min, 5.0mL) |
BD Barricor™ (4000G/3 min, 4.5 mL) |
| Clotting time/compatible with anti-coagulated blood | 30 min | 0 min |
| Centrifugation time | 10 min | 3 min |
| Gel globules | Episodic | None |
| Fibrin masses | Risk when insufficiently clotted | Anticoagulated specimen - no fibrin mass |
| Chemistry stability1 |
7 day stability for many analytes | 7 day stability for most analytes including analytes sensitive to cellular contamination (AST, K, Phosphate) |
| TDM stability2 |
13+ analytes, not including hydrophobic drugs | 7 day stability for representative TDMs including hydrophobic drugs |
| Sample yield | 46% | 43% - (0.15 mL less sample vs serum in BD SST™ 4.5 mL) |
| Infectious diseases | Yes | Yes (CE marked product only) |
| Donor screening for infectious disease | Yes | Currently heparinized plasma is not used by blood banks for donor screening |
AST: aspartate aminotransferase, K: potassium, TDM: therapeutic drug monitoring
1Analyte stability tested at 24 hrs room temperature and additional 6 days refrigerated (2 - 8°C)
2Analyte stability tested at 48 hrs room temperature and additional 5 days refrigerated (2 - 8°C)
